框架基本約定

2018-02-05 10:44 更新


框架核心文件中都帶有大量注譯,且框架結(jié)構(gòu)用最貼近人的思維邏輯搭建,方便大家閱讀與理解。以面向應(yīng)用為主,不糾結(jié)于OOP,不糾結(jié)于MVC,不糾結(jié)于設(shè)計(jì)模式,不拘一格,力求簡(jiǎn)單快速優(yōu)質(zhì)的完成項(xiàng)目開發(fā)。

約定一:請(qǐng)求地址格式:http://www.域名.com/應(yīng)用名(默認(rèn)應(yīng)用可省略)/控制器名/方法名/參數(shù)_值_參數(shù)_值.html (.html可加可不加)
約定二:如請(qǐng)求地址沒有帶應(yīng)用名,默認(rèn)省略應(yīng)用名 default,應(yīng)用名的作用無非是可以拆分系統(tǒng),控制框架到那個(gè)文件夾里去調(diào)用對(duì)應(yīng)控制器,比如實(shí)際開發(fā)時(shí)常把后臺(tái)管理系統(tǒng)當(dāng)成一個(gè)應(yīng)用獨(dú)立出來。
約定三:控制器命名規(guī)則,控制器文件名必須是 控制器名_controller.php,類名 控制器名_controller 注意全小寫,應(yīng)用默認(rèn)控制器為index_controller.php,如不存在則調(diào)用empty_controller.php。
約定四:控制器默認(rèn)方法名 為 index,如默認(rèn)方法不存在 則調(diào)用 _empty。


以上內(nèi)容是否對(duì)您有幫助:
在線筆記
App下載
App下載

掃描二維碼

下載編程獅App

公眾號(hào)
微信公眾號(hào)

編程獅公眾號(hào)